About the Webinar

The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) carries out different types of reviews to ensure that the information provided by taxpayers is in accordance with tax laws and to verify that the amount of taxes reported is correct. This webinar will teach participants how to prepare for an IRS audit, how to create a robust, audit-proof documentation package, and understand what type of legal assistance will best suit you / your clients on a case-by-case basis.

Participants will earn 1.0 CE credit at the end of this session. To earn credit, participants must answer three of four probing questions asked during the program.

At the end of this webinar, you will be able to;

  • Understand how many types of audits you can expect from the IRS.
  • Know the typical reasons for being selected for an audit.
  • Know how to create an audit-proof documentation package.
  • Identify the appropriate legal representation depending on your case.
  • Prepare your clients for any type of IRS audit.
